This refers to the inspection conducted by Mr. T. E. Conlon of this office

on November 18, 1978, of activities authorized by NRC Operating License

No. DPR-71 for the Brunswick Steam Electric Plant Unit I facility, and to

the discussion of our findings held with Mr. W. Tucker at the conclusion of

the inspection.

Areas examined during the inspection and our findings are discussed in the

enclosed inspection report. Within these areas, the inspection consisted of

selective examinations of procedures and representative records, interviews

with personnel, and observations by the inspector.

Within the scope of this inspection, no items of noncompliance were

disclosed.
